🎯 Purpose Lab Media Player Demo

Adam walked through True Guide's latest technology — an "ultra smart media player" built for Purpose Lab, which currently houses 70 high-quality interviews from Zinka's content catalog (05:55). The player features several key capabilities:

  • Content discovery — users ask a question and the player surfaces relevant interview snippets from the catalog, matching content to the user's inquiry
  • Multi-language captions — designed for audiences where English is a secondary language, with toggleable caption display
  • Sharing — clips can be shared to WhatsApp communities, personal contacts, or other channels
  • Summary view — provides an overview of what's in the player
  • Call to action — a section that Purpose Lab plans to build out for deeper engagement pathways

The player is currently being piloted with other clients and Adam sees it as one of the strongest offerings in the Purpose Lab ecosystem (09:45). He emphasized that the technology is ready to scale but needs a committed content partner to build on it.

🔗 Urban Monk Personalization Pilot

Adam demonstrated a pilot project with Urban Monk, a client with 20,000 people in their ecosystem (20:44). The flow works as follows:

  1. Users enter the mid-funnel and complete a detailed survey/assessment
  2. The survey generates a score and identifies key concerns
  3. True Guide's API delivers a fully customized media player within ~20 seconds — personalized to that specific user's survey responses
  4. The player surfaces relevant content snippets addressing their concerns
  5. A discovery path leads to deeper engagement and conversion
